What will the apprentice be doing?

Responsibilities:

  • Assist with offer packs, contracts of employments, change to contract letters & leaver letters
  • Responsible for updating group organogram charts on a regular basis
  • Assist with data inputting of employment details onto HR database
  • In liaison with the talent team, administer the Central Registers and HR trackers ensuring they are all maintained and accurate
  • In liaison with the talent team, ensure all Right to Work details are up to date and meet UKVI regulations
  • Assist with the management of the HR inbox SYSAID and answer general queries
  • Administer employee references in a timely manner
  • Ensure the maintenance of employee records, ensuring complete accuracy and confidentiality
  • Assist with general copying, filing, archiving of documents as required
  • Provide the first point of contact in a polite and professional manner for the main telephone number and calls from reception
  • Provide a high level of customer service
  • Attend to ad hoc requests from the HR team in a timely and polite manner
  • Provide support to HRBP’s / HR advisors in note taking and administration of employee relations case work
  • Deliver support to the HRPB’s and HR advisors on a wide range of HR projects
